Wouldn't change a thing

“ Wouldn't Change a Thing ” - a song by Australian singer Kylie Minogue . First, in July 1989, she was released as a separate single , and then on the second studio album, released in October, singer Enjoy Yourself (1989).

In the UK, the single with the song "Wouldn't Change a Thing" reached 2nd place (in the national single chart ) [1] .

Creation History

The song was written and produced by the author and producer trio of Stock, Aitken and Waterman .
